The 12 Principles of Agile — Simplified

Each principle is rewritten in plain English and tied to real team behavior.

  1. Deliver value frequently and learn fast.
  2. Welcome changes — even late ones.
  3. Ship working software regularly.
  4. Business + tech must collaborate daily.
  5. Build projects around motivated people.
  6. Communicate face-to-face whenever possible.
  7. Working software is the measure of progress.
  8. Maintain a sustainable pace.
  9. Technical excellence improves agility.
  10. Simplicity — maximize “not doing.”
  11. Self-organizing teams produce the best results.
  12. Reflect and improve every sprint.